Rock Shock Service?

Featured Replies

Looking to have my Rock Shocks serviced, preferably in Chiang Mai but will send out if nec. Been to all the usually suspects in CM w/o any luck. Anybody have any ideas?

Call Worldbike In Bangkok, being the sole agent in Thailand they should be able to help you. wink.png

here is their number: 02-9464117-9

  • 1 month later...

DIY, JC! Really easy, look here, SRAM gives perfect advices: http://www.sram.com/service. You'll find also a lot of videos from other parties how to maintain your RockShox (Be aware of the right spelling!) fork properly (Google is your friend). I'm sure you have almost everything you need at home. The oils are available at least at Jacky's, they also should be able to source spare parts in case you need some.
